Target Bonus Pool definition

Target Bonus Pool or “Target Pool” shall mean the amount anticipated to be distributed to all Designated and Non-Designated Participants if all applicable Performance Goals are met at targeted levels. Separate Target Bonus Pools may be established for URS and for one or more of its Affiliates and business units, as determined by the Committee.
Target Bonus Pool means an amount equal to twenty-five percent (25%) (or such greater percentage as the Committee may determine in its sole discretion) of the aggregate amount of the Base Salaries of all Participants for such Award Year.
Target Bonus Pool means an amount determined by the Committee each year in its sole discretion to be allocated to the Plan, assuming achievement of at least 90% of the EBITDA Target.

  • Bonus Payment means a cash payment in an amount equal to the sum of (i) all Excise Taxes payable by the Executive, plus (ii) all additional Excise Taxes and federal or state income taxes to the extent such taxes are imposed in respect of the Bonus Payment, such that the Executive shall be in the same after-tax position and shall have received the same benefits that he would have received if the Excise Taxes had not been imposed. For purposes of calculating any income taxes attributable to the Bonus Payment, the Executive shall be deemed for all purposes to be paying income taxes at the highest marginal federal income tax rate, taking into account any applicable surtaxes and other generally applicable taxes which have the effect of increasing the marginal federal income tax rate and, if applicable, at the highest marginal state income tax rate, to which the Bonus Payment and the Executive are subject. An example of the calculation of the Bonus Payment is set forth below. Assume that the Excise Tax rate is 20%, the highest federal marginal income tax rate is 40% and the Executive is not subject to state income taxes. Further assume that the Executive has received an excess parachute payment in the amount of $200,000, on which $40,000 ($200,000 x 20%) in Excise Taxes are payable. The amount of the required Bonus Payment is thus computed to be $100,000, i.e., the Bonus Payment of $100,000, less additional Excise Taxes on the Bonus Payment of $20,000 (i.e., 20% x $100,000) and income taxes of $40,000 (i.e., 40% x $100,000), yields $40,000, the amount of the Excise Taxes payable in respect of the original excess parachute payment.
